I am defendant in a injunction suite and the plaintiff lost the case as he couldn't prove the existence of schedule property as he purchased the land based on fabricated document. The plaintiff is a Notorious person. After loosing the case also he continues to use the land. What should I do legally. Please suggest step wise.

PARDEEP KUMAR DHINGRA

Responded 5 years ago

A.WHAT RIGHT, TITLE AND INTEREST YOU HAVE IN THE PROPERTY, PLEASE LET US KNOW THE SAME, BEFORE GUIDING YOU FURTHER. YOU NEED TO FILE SUIT FOR POSSESSION/INJUNCTION/MESNE PROFITS WITH DECLARATION OF TITLE(WHICH DEPENDS UPON WHAT RIGHT, TITLE OR INTEREST YOU HAVE)
POSSESSION IS 9/10TH OWNERSHIP, YOU SHOULD HAVE BETTER TITLE THAN HE HAS.

Hi Pardeep Kumar Sir,
The land was purchased by my grand father and after his time his two sons didn't get into partition. The younger son is my father. My father's elder brother sold half of the land .5 Ac to 3rd party. My father protested the transaction and objected the construction. This lead the 3rd party approached the court for permanent injunction and we fought the case. I want the land which was sold by my father's elder brother without partition. Please guide us sir
